Output 5418e81370337bdf953c51eec52060c100e00460a0167b49f871b79ba9e3be22:5

value
4987787
script pubkey
OP_0 OP_PUSHBYTES_20 16626557c0c402c0b5099107d906d9d45e0b0da7
address
bc1qze3x247qcspvpdgfjyrajpke630qkrd82cmx7r
transaction
5418e81370337bdf953c51eec52060c100e00460a0167b49f871b79ba9e3be22
confirmations
71482
spent
true